Abstract:Objective To analyze the effect of different blepharoplasties combined with small incision liposuction on plastic effects in patients with asymmetric double eyelid. Methods A total of 88 patients with asymmetric double eyelid admitted to Plastic Surgery Department of Nantong Chunshushang Medical Beauty Clinic from October 2022 to June 2024 were selected as the research subjects, and they were randomly divided into control group and study group, with 44 patients in each group. The control group was treated with conventional incision blepharoplasty combined with small incision liposuction, and the study group was treated with continuous buried suture blepharoplasty combined with small incision liposuction. The clinical related indexes, clinical efficacy, patient satisfaction and complication rate were compared between the two groups. Results The operation time and wound healing time in the study group were shorter than those in the control group, and the intraoperative blood loss was less than that in the control group (P <0.05). The total effective rate of treatment in the study group (95.45%) was higher than that in the control group (81.82%) (P <0.05). The patient satisfaction in the study group (93.18%) was higher than that in the control group (77.27%) (P <0.05). The incidence of complications in the study group (4.55%) was lower than that in the control group (18.18%) (P <0.05). Conclusion The effect of continuous buried suture blepharoplasty combined with small incision liposuction in the plastic surgery treatment of patients with asymmetric double eyelid is better, with less trauma, faster postoperative recovery and fewer postoperative complications, while patients are more satisfied with the restoration effect.
